Abstract:Inthe modern steelindustry,thefurnace coil rolling millisakeyequipment for producing medium and thick plates.The surfacequalityofsteel plates is of vital importance,buttheproblemof iron oxide scale affcts the qualityof steel plates and thecompetitiveness ofenterprises.In the productionof the funacecoilrollng millofNanjing Ironand Steel Company,the problem of iron oxide scale breakage and shedding of steel plates with a thickness of ⩾16mm is prominent,which afects the surfacequalityand the benefits of the enterprise.This study analyzed the manifestations,hazardsand processfactors influencing thecrushing and shedding of iron oxidescale,and found that there were deficiencies inthe hating,roling,descaling and coling processes.Byoptimizing the heating temperature system,rolling process parameters,upgrading the descaling system,formulating arefined coling plan and implementing it inphases,the improvedoxidescale structure becomes denser,theadhesion is enhanced,andthesurface qualityand production indicators of the steel platearesignificantly improved,providing technical reference forthe industry.Inthe future, it can further develop in the direction of intelligence and low consumption.
Keywords: furnacecoil rollng mill;iron oxide scale; processoptimization;descaling system;colingscheme;surface quality
